Shoaib Malik Calls for Major Overhaul of Pakistan Test Cricket Structure After Bangladesh Whitewash

Former captain urges stronger domestic red-ball system and better financial incentives for specialists

KARACHI — Former Pakistan captain Shoaib Malik has called for sweeping reforms in Pakistan’s Test cricket structure, urging authorities to strengthen the domestic red-ball system and offer better financial incentives to specialist players.

His comments come in the wake of a disappointing Test series performance by Pakistan national cricket team, which suffered a 2–0 whitewash against Bangladesh national cricket team under the captaincy of Shan Masood.

“Reward Red-Ball Specialists” — Malik’s Key Proposal

Shoaib Malik emphasized that Pakistan must prioritize red-ball specialists by introducing improved central contracts and targeted incentives.

He argued that better financial security would encourage players to stay committed to first-class cricket instead of drifting toward franchise leagues.

Push for Mandatory First-Class Participation

Malik proposed that players should be required to participate in at least five first-class matches per season to remain fully connected with the longer format of the game.

He believes this would help maintain technical consistency and rebuild the foundation of Pakistan’s Test cricket standards.

Concerns Over Franchise Cricket Influence

The former captain warned that growing pressure from franchise cricket is affecting players’ natural development in the longer format.

He stressed that without structural balance, players may continue to prioritize short-format leagues over national red-ball duties.

“Full Preparation Needed for International Success”

Malik highlighted the gap between domestic and international cricket standards, stating that partial preparation is not enough at the highest level.

He urged cricket authorities to ensure players enter international cricket fully prepared, committed, and technically sound.

Main Takeaway

Shoaib Malik’s remarks underline a growing concern over Pakistan’s declining Test performance and call for urgent reforms in domestic red-ball cricket, better contracts for specialists, and stricter first-class participation rules to rebuild long-format strength.
